引言

MyEclipse是一款广泛使用的Java集成开发环境(IDE),它为开发者提供了强大的Web项目开发和管理功能。高效部署Web项目是确保项目稳定运行的关键环节。本文将深入探讨如何利用MyEclipse实现Web项目的高效部署,并提供实战秘籍。

1. MyEclipse简介

1.1 MyEclipse特点

  • 强大的开发工具:支持Java、JSP、Servlet、EJB等开发技术。
  • 集成的数据库工具:提供数据库设计、管理和调试工具。
  • 丰富的插件:扩展功能,满足不同开发需求。

1.2 MyEclipse版本

  • MyEclipse Classic:基础版,适用于入门级开发者。
  • MyEclipse Professional:专业版,适合中高级开发者。
  • MyEclipse Enterprise Workbench:企业版,适用于企业级开发。

2. Web项目部署流程

2.1 创建Web项目

  1. 打开MyEclipse,选择“File” > “New” > “Web Project”。
  2. 输入项目名称,选择Web项目版本,点击“Finish”。

2.2 配置项目

  1. 设置项目部署路径:在项目属性中,选择“Deployment” > “Deployment Assembly”。
  2. 添加Web模块:在“Web Modules”标签页中,点击“Add”添加Web模块。
  3. 配置部署描述符:在“Web Deployment Descriptor”标签页中,配置项目部署信息。

2.3 部署项目

  1. 选择服务器:在项目属性中,选择“Deployment” > “Targeted Runtimes”。
  2. 部署到服务器:点击“Deploy”按钮,将项目部署到服务器。

3. 高效部署实战秘籍

3.1 使用Maven

  1. 添加Maven插件:在项目属性中,选择“Run/Debug Settings” > “Maven”。
  2. 配置Maven项目:添加Maven依赖和插件,实现自动化构建和部署。

3.2 使用Tomcat

  1. 安装Tomcat:下载并安装Tomcat服务器。
  2. 配置Tomcat:在Tomcat的“conf”目录下修改“server.xml”文件,配置虚拟主机和端口号。
  3. 部署项目到Tomcat:将项目部署到Tomcat的“webapps”目录下。

3.3 使用Nginx

  1. 安装Nginx:下载并安装Nginx服务器。
  2. 配置Nginx:在Nginx的“conf”目录下修改“nginx.conf”文件,配置反向代理和负载均衡。
  3. 部署项目到Nginx:将项目部署到Nginx的“html”目录下。

3.4 使用Docker

  1. 安装Docker:下载并安装Docker。
  2. 创建Dockerfile:编写Dockerfile,定义项目构建和部署过程。
  3. 构建和运行容器:使用Docker命令构建和运行容器。

4. 总结

通过本文的实战秘籍,您已经掌握了MyEclipse高效部署Web项目的方法。在实际开发过程中,灵活运用这些技巧,可以大大提高Web项目的部署效率。祝您在Web开发的道路上越走越远!